Members and guests packed the private room at The Back Burner Restaurant for the Georgia Utility Contractors Association (GUCA) central Georgia Industry Luncheon on April 2. More than 30 members and guests filled the back room of this dining spot in Macon, Ga., to hear time sensitive information, network and enjoy lunch. This was an open invitation event for GUCA members, prospective members, municipalities and government officials in the area and throughout the state.
The keynote speaker for this meeting was Steve Adams, Macon/Bibb County industrial authority. Steve delivered a presentation on Project Activity in Macon/Bibb County Area and Region and highlighted current projects and their successes. He spoke about the economic development trends, source of project’s recruitment, site location factors and, available labor supply and mission of authority. He introduced the local vendor program and encouraged those from the Macon area to join. He said this program is an effort to ensure new and expanding companies in Macon/Bibb county are aware of local contractors and their capabilities.
GUCA Membership Committee Chairman Ed Shipley, RDJE Inc., welcomed everyone to the meeting and thanked Bituminous Insurance Co., Foley Products Company and Sterling Risk Advisors for their generous sponsorships. Shipley also encouraged members to stay active and participate in future GUCA functions. The importance of generating new membership was emphasized and he strongly encouraged promoting membership and recruiting in the area to strengthen GUCA’s Central Georgia membership.
GUCA Executive Director Vikki Consiglio also updated those in attendance about upcoming events, safety classes and industry and legislative issues. She introduced representatives who highlighted the GUCA affinity programs including the Georgia Health Plan Trust, 401k savings plan and Bituminous Safety Dividend Program — GUCA’s newest affinity addition.
